Overview

The Core Roamer S is a compact, surf-shaped wing foil board from German brand Core, designed as the performance-focused complement to their standard Roamer. Where the Roamer prioritizes stability and ease of use across a wide volume range, the Roamer S strips things down with a pointed nose, narrow tail, and lower-volume sizing aimed at agile, surf-style riding on foil. The board is manufactured in Portugal using a full-carbon vacuum-infused layup around a closed-cell XPS foam core — a construction method that keeps swing weight low while maintaining rigidity. Core positions it as their most maneuverable wing foil board, suitable for experienced riders and lighter pilots who want a direct connection to the foil.

The deck shape draws from skateboard design: a straight midsection with subtle rise toward the nose and tail gives tactile orientation underfoot, which matters for strapless riding and prone foil takeoffs. A double concave with a central spine runs along the bottom, softening touchdowns and aiding foil reattachment after aerial maneuvers. The board ships with a US-Box track system, EVA deck pad with foot-position guides, two recessed leash plugs, and a carry handle on the underside.

Key Specs

  • 38L: 4'5" x 21" x 3 3/16"
  • 45L: 4'8" x 22 3/16" x 3 3/8"
  • 63L: 4'11" x 22" x 4 11/16"
  • 78L: 5'3" x 22 7/16" x 5 3/8"
  • 90L: 5'9" x 22" x 5 1/2"
  • Construction: Full carbon, vacuum-infused over XPS closed-cell foam
  • Manufacturing: Made in Europe (Portugal)
  • Foil mount: US-Box track system
  • Strap inserts: 12 front foot / 10 rear foot (M6 stainless steel)
  • Included: Deck pad, two leash plugs, bottom grab handle

Who It's For

The Roamer S in the 38L and 45L sizes offered here is a sinker board — it won't float a rider at rest, so water starts and consistent pumping ability are prerequisites. These volumes suit experienced wing foilers and lighter riders (roughly under 75 kg) who have moved past the learning phase and want a board that disappears underfoot once on foil. The surf-oriented outline and low swing weight also make the smaller sizes viable crossover platforms for prone foiling.

Riders who need buoyancy for water starts or who are still developing their foil control will find the standard Core Roamer (starting at 55L with wider dimensions) a more forgiving platform. The Roamer S rewards committed technique with tight, responsive turning and minimal drag during carved maneuvers — it's tuned for wave riding on foil, freestyle tricks, and riders who prioritize feel over float.

In the Lineup

Within Core's wing board range, the Roamer S sits above the standard Roamer as the dedicated performance option. The Roamer covers the accessible end of the spectrum from 55L to 130L, emphasizing forward drive and stability. The Roamer S overlaps only at the top of its range (the 78L and 90L sizes share similar volumes with the smaller Roamers) but uses a distinctly narrower, more surf-derived outline at every size.

Compared to competing surf-style wing boards in the compact sinker category, the Roamer S lines up against boards like the F-One Rocket S and the Fanatic Sky Surf. Its European carbon construction and XPS closed-cell core place it at a premium price point, backed by Core's six-year parts-availability guarantee. For riders shopping the 38–45L size bracket specifically, the choice typically comes down to how much surf-style maneuverability matters versus raw early planing speed.
